The annual salary statistics of mechanical door repairers in Philadelphia-Camden-Wilmington, Pennsylvania is shown in Table 1. The wage information of mechanical door repairers in Philadelphia-Camden-Wilmington is based on the national compensation survey conducted by the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ics in 2022 and published in April 2023 [1].
Percentile Bracket | Average Annual Salary |
---|---|
10th Percentile Wage | $20,800 |
25th Percentile Wage | $39,280 |
50th Percentile Wage | $49,130 |
75th Percentile Wage | $61,250 |
90th Percentile Wage | $75,910 |
Table 1 shows the average annual salary for mechanical door repairers in Philadelphia-Camden-Wilmington, Pennsylvania in 5 percentile scales. The average annual salary for the 90th percentile (the top 10 percent of the highest paid) is $75,910. The median (50th percentile) annual salary is $49,130. The average annual salary for the bottom 10 percent earners is $20,800.
The table and chart below show the trend of the median salary of mechanical door repairers from 2012 to 2022.
Year | Median Salary | Yearly Growth | 10-Year Growth |
---|---|---|---|
2022 | $49,130 | 5.03% | 16.67% |
2021 | $46,660 | 2.89% | - |
2020 | $45,310 | 0.60% | - |
2019 | $45,040 | -3.35% | - |
2018 | $46,550 | 10.40% | - |
2017 | $41,710 | -2.54% | - |
2016 | $42,770 | 9.10% | - |
2015 | $38,880 | -14.33% | - |
2014 | $44,450 | 2.41% | - |
2013 | $43,380 | 5.62% | - |
2012 | $40,940 | - | - |
